Life Tip #10: Take the Scenic Route
Apr 25th, 2007 by jeremy
How much of a routine oriented person are you. Admittedly I fall into this category. I like to call myself an efficiency oriented person, but once I find what I think to be the most efficient routine, that is the one I will always follow.
Because I recognize my tendency to fall into routines, I like to consciously vary what I am doing. Why? Simply for the sake of doing something different to vary my day. Though a life of routine can be very good, it can also be boring.
One simple way you can do this is to vary your route you drive. Whether it be your daily commute to work, to the store, or anything like this, try a different route. Of course this may not be all that possible based on where you live, but even if parts of the route are the same, take a few different turns even if it means driving a few extra blocks or even miles.
You’ll be suprised how much more you actually look at your surroundings when you are taking a different route. You may notice new landscaping someone has done, see different people, or perhaps think to talk to someone you haven’t seen in awhile. Your brain will be stimulated with new thoughts and ideas, all by this simple act.
So, on your next drive, try out a different path to your destination and see what it does for you.
